RightTappedRoutedEventArgs.GetPosition(UIElement)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Retourne les coordonnées x et y de la position du pointeur, éventuellement évaluées par rapport à l’origine des coordonnées d’un élément UIElement fourni.
public:
virtual Point GetPosition(UIElement ^ relativeTo) = GetPosition;
Point GetPosition(UIElement const& relativeTo);
public Point GetPosition(UIElement relativeTo);
function getPosition(relativeTo)
Public Function GetPosition (relativeTo As UIElement) As Point
Paramètres
- relativeTo
- UIElement
Tout objet dérivé d’UIElement connecté à la même arborescence d’objets. Pour spécifier l’objet par rapport au système de coordonnées global, utilisez une valeur relativeTo de null.
Retours
Point qui représente les coordonnées x et y actuelles de la position du pointeur de la souris. Si null a été passé en tant que relativeTo, cette coordonnée correspond à la fenêtre globale. Si une valeur relativeTo autre que null a été transmise, cette coordonnée est relative à l’objet référencé par relativeTo.
Remarques
Comportement de Windows 8
Windows 8 a rencontré un problème avec les données de l’événement RightTapped , où les valeurs X et Y pour le point que vous obtiendriez à partir de RightTappedRoutedEventArgs.GetPosition ont été inversées (X était vraiment Y ; Y était vraiment X). Ce problème a été résolu à partir de Windows 8.1. Mais si vous recibez une application Windows 8 pour Windows 8.1, vous avez peut-être eu du code qui a fonctionné pour résoudre ce problème en remplaçant les X et Y. Si c’est le cas, supprimez ce code lorsque vous reciblez à nouveau, car le problème est maintenant résolu.
Les applications qui ont été compilées pour Windows 8, mais qui sont exécutées dans Windows 8.1, continuent d’appliquer le comportement Windows 8.